new mission president

New Mexico Farmington Mission


David G. and Cherie Adams

David Grant Adams, 61, and Cherie Jensen Adams, three children, Dry Canyon Ward, Logan Utah Mount Logan Stake: New Mexico Farmington Mission, succeeding President Doyle L. Batt and Sister Karen Batt. Brother Adams serves as a ward missionary and is a former stake president, bishop, and high councilor. President, Adams Construction Company, Inc. Born in Riverside, California, to Grant Allen Adams and Verlene Palmer Adams.
Sister Adams is serving as a ward missionary and is a former ward Primary president, counselor in a stake Primary presidency, and institute women’s adviser. Born in Sacramento, California, to Harold F. Jensen and Carol Lou Moser Jensen.

They will replace:

Doyle L. and Karen C. Batt
Doyle Lee Batt, 62, and Karen Clayson Batt, five children, New Mexico Farmington Mission; Coltman 1st Ward, Idaho Falls East Stake. Brother Batt serves as a ward missionary and is a former stake president and counselor, stake and ward Young Men president, bishop, Cub Scout leader and missionary in the Northern Indian Mission. Retired engineering manager, Idaho National Engineering Lab. Born in Idaho Falls, Idaho, to Melvin Lee and Nora Martin Batt.
Sister Batt serves as a counselor in a ward Relief Society presidency and is a former stake and ward Young Women president, Primary president, Primary music leader and gospel doctrine teacher. Born in Sheridan, Wyo., to Eli Karl and Beulah Memmott Clayson.
